Day by Day Summary and Map
Tour # 1A 10 Night Talkeetna Treasures (Post-Cruise) from Vancouver
7 Nt Cruise + 1 Nt Talkeetna + 1 Nt Denali + 1 Nt Anchorage
Direction: Southbound from Vancouver to Anchorage
Alaska Wildlife Conservation Center, United States
Bus Travel
Anchorage, United States
Bus Travel
Talkeetna, United States
Meet your tour director at the pier in Seward. Board your deluxe motorcoach, and travel to the Alaska Wildlife Conservation Center. Encounter Alaska's famed wildlife up-close as you observe animals indigenous to the area before journeying to Anchorage, Alaska's most cosmopolitan city. Explore the downtown area and enjoy lunch on your own. Travel by deluxe motorcoach to the charming Alaskan town of Talkeetna. From 4:30 pm, Talkeetna is yours to explore. Stroll past Main Street's lively brew pubs and converted air streams, serving signature dishes. Take in breathtaking views of Denali and mingle with the locals who keep the backcountry spirit of Alaska alive. Overnight at the Talkeetna Alaskan Lodge. ... Read More

Day 9
Talkeetna, United States
Bus Travel
Denali National Park, United States
Enjoy an early-morning scenic drive from Talkeetna to one of Alaska's most treasured landmarks, Denali. After lunch on your own at the Visitor Center, venture across Denali National Park on the Denali Natural History Tour. Discover the beauty of taiga forests and gaze at miles of rolling tundra, while searching for wildlife. After your tour, Denali is yours to discover. Book an optional land excursion with your tour director to soar over Denali, "The Great One", on a flightseeing plane, or raft down the Nenana River. Overnight at Denali Park Village. ... Read More

Day 10
Denali National Park, United States
Wilderness Express Train Travel
Anchorage, United States
Craft your own unique Alaskan adventure in the morning, such as a visit to the Denali Visitor Center, with its fascinating natural history exhibits and films, or book an optional land excursion to visit the sled dogs of the Husky Homestead. Today, board the glass-domed Wilderness Express railcar for a picturesque ride on your journey to Anchorage. From 8:30 pm, Anchorage is yours to explore. Enjoy the evening, dining or strolling under the midnight sun. Overnight at the Anchorage Marriott. ... Read More
